Yesterday, I upgraded from 6.8.3 to 6.9.2.  At some point last night, my server went offline (crashed?).  I restarted it manually and upon restart the parity check began.  The parity check started off smoothly (~130MB/s), but soon slowed to a crawl (5.7MB/s - and dropping).  I have stopped all of my dockers and VMs. 

 

I've attached the diagnostics

 

Note - I have a 30TB array (10 x 3TB + 2 x 3TB for parity).  It usually takes me about 8 hours to complete a parity check.

Are there any errors in the Errors column on Main for any array disks? Do any of your disks have SMART warnings on the Dashboard page?

 

Oct 14 10:17:02 RENFREWNAS kernel: BUG: unable to handle page fault for address: 0000000000200014
Oct 14 10:17:02 RENFREWNAS kernel: #PF: supervisor read access in kernel mode
Oct 14 10:17:02 RENFREWNAS kernel: #PF: error_code(0x0000) - not-present page
Oct 14 10:17:02 RENFREWNAS kernel: PGD 0 P4D 0 
Oct 14 10:17:02 RENFREWNAS kernel: Oops: 0000 [#1] SMP PTI

Have you done memtest?

 

Setup syslog server so you can get syslog if it crashes again.

There are no errors on the Main page for any of my disks.  No SMART warnings in the dashboard either.  I have not run a memtest.

 

I just setup the syslog server (to flash) and will monitor if a crash occurs again.

The Unraid driver is crashing, this happens with some hardware, don't no the reason or a solution, you can try v6.10-rc, it might not happen with the newer kernel.

This was what I was afraid of...

 

Can I roll back to 6.8.3?  Edit - I'm restoring back to 6.8.3 now...
